    irevolution,
    all shock absorbers are oil filled to dampen suspension oscillation to reduce the wavy ride and to keep the vehicle's tire in contact with the road. if you were to drive in a bumpy road, the oil passes through small orifices or drilled passages on the shock absorber piston several times a minute. this causes the oil to get hot and lose viscosity therefore you have the shock absorber fade (shock absorber inefficiency) when this happens. to prevent or reduce this unwanted effect, the shock absorber is pressurized with nitrogen to raise its boililng point and in turn reduce the shock absorber fade. why nitrogen? because nitrogen is an inert gas (does not support oxidation) which is stable until it reaches about 2800 degrees fahrenheit, then it starts to combust. it does not react with the oil inside your shocks.

    granro01,
    from the write up, you would deduce that the gas charged is more stable from shock absorber fade. i haven't come across pure gas shock absober yet. do you mind telling me the brand? all shock absorbers i have seen since i started tinkering with vehicles had hydraulic oil in them. thanks
